Australia releases new guidelines to protect trans gymnasts

Australia’s governing body over the sport of gymnastics, Gymnastics Australia, has just released new guidelines protecting transgender and gender-diverse athletes within their sport. Unlike other sporting organizations around the globe, who are currently making concerted efforts to alienate and exclude the trans community, Gymnastics Australia is stepping out and ruling in favor of its transgender and gender-diverse participants and competitors. 

The new guidelines allow athletes to choose uniforms that align with their chosen gender identity, rather than whatever they were assigned at birth, and stress the idea of comfort while working and competing in Australian Gymnastics spaces. 

Alexandra Ash, the CEO of Gymnastics Australia states that the organization is determined to “foster safe and inclusive environments” for those invested in the sport. 

On the issue of bathrooms and change rooms, Gymnastics Australia says in its guidelines that individuals “have a right to use changing and bathroom facilities which best reflect their gender identity.”

The organization did state, however, that their jurisdiction over elite and sub-elite competitions is limited and the guidelines for those particular events are set by an international federation. They would, however, ensure that all community events and leagues would allow individuals to participate in the events that best reflect their gender identity. 

A far cry from many of the sporting federations around the world right now, Gymnastics Australia’s opening statement of their new guidelines reads as follows:

“Gymnastics Australia is committed to providing a safe, fun and inclusive environment for all people, including those of diverse sexualities and genders. Being an inclusive organisation not only reflects our core values, it also reflects the diversity of our local communities.

The Gymnastics Australia Guidelines for the Inclusion of Transgender and Gender Diverse People in Community Gymnastics (this document) have been developed to ensure all Australians can participate in both recreational and competitive gymnastics. We recognise that the inclusion of transgender and gender diverse people within sport is a complex and emotive issue, and it is important to note that these guidelines are focused on creating and fostering inclusive environments.

We’re passionate about helping people lead happy, healthy and active lives. Gymnastics Australia celebrates diversity of sex, gender identity, gender expression, sexual orientation, intersex status ability, skill, cultural background, ethnicity, location, religious or political beliefs, and life stage.

There is a place in our sport for everyone, exactly as you are.”
